WebbWhile coffee has more caffeine than tea on average, tea still provides many people with that extra burst of energy that they crave in the mornings. At the same time, it is much easier to control the level of caffeine in tea than it is with coffee, making it a preferred beverage for many individuals who are watching their daily intake.
